Précédent   Forum des professionnels en informatique > Webmasters - Développement Web > AJAX
AJAX Forum sur la programmation AJAX. Avant de poster : Cours AJAX, FAQ AJAX, Toutes les FAQ JavaScript
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 22/11/2011, 13h24   #1
Invité de passage
 
Inscription : novembre 2009
Messages : 6
Détails du profil
Informations forums :
Inscription : novembre 2009
Messages : 6
Points : 3
Points : 3
Par défaut Envois de donnees en Ajax(Jquery) + redirection

Bonjour,
J'ai un petit soucis et je commence a ne plus avoir les idees claires,
je souhaiterai faire ce que fait un formulaire classique, c'est a dire envoyer des donnees en post, se rediriger sur la page cible et recuperer mes donnes sur cette meme page mais cela en Ajax (JQuery), car je ne peux pas utiliser de formulaire dans le cas present, existe t'il une solution ou suis-je oblige de passer par un fichier XML ou autre?
Pour vous eclairer voila le code que j'ai essaye:
Code :
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
 
function test(database, host, user, pwd, num, tbl){
	var postPdf= "database=" + database + "&host=" + host + "&user=" + user + "&pwd=" + pwd + "&table=" + tbl + "&id=" + num;
 
	var sData = postPdf;
	$.ajax({
	    type: 'POST',
	    url: 'pdf.php',
	    data: (sData) , 
		success: function(msg) {
			window.location.href="pdf.php"; //redirection vers pdf,php
			alert(msg); //je n'ai evidamment pas d'alert et $_POST est vide sur pdf.php
    	}
	});
}
Voila j'envois donc les donnees a pdf.php puis je me redirige sur cette meme page mais evidamment cela ne marche pas, je n'ai pas les donnees . Une idee?

Ps: desole pour les accents je suis sur un clavier qwerty
R2dread2 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 23/11/2011, 10h35   #2
Invité de passage
 
Inscription : novembre 2009
Messages : 6
Détails du profil
Informations forums :
Inscription : novembre 2009
Messages : 6
Points : 3
Points : 3
Bon bin je me suis finalement motive a changer mon code et a utiliser un formulaire classique, sinon ca me faisait faire un from dans un form, ce qui n'est pas terrible et cela ne marche pas correctement et puis je genere du code avec du php et out un tas de variables, gallere mais mintenant ca marche nikel^^
R2dread2 est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ité Cette discussion est résolue.
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 17h15.


 
 
 
 
Partenaires

Hébergement Web